Fusilier’s Arch, St Stephen’s Green
Right in the center of Dublin lies its most well-known park.
On a bright day, groups of Dubliners can be seen relaxing on the grass with coffees and picnic lunches in between manicured flower gardens.
Keep an eye on the duck pond because Dublin's notoriously irate seagulls have settled there and are acting like ducks in order to rob unsuspecting tourists of their food.
Surprisingly, they hold up.
Open all year round.
Monday – Saturday: 7.30am – dusk.
Sunday and bank holidays: 9.30am – dusk.
Christmas Day: 9.30am- 12.30pm
There is no charge for entry.
